In order to keep the maximum Selection Index at 228, a students SAT score in each section is capped at 760, just as it would be on the PSAT. PSAT scores set the cutoffs, and AE students were added on top the the PSAT Semifinalists and Commended Students. It does not matter if one state has far more test takers or high scorers than another, since the 50,000 is tabulated from all PSAT takers. This means that any student in the country (or eligible student studying abroad) with a score of 224 or higher will qualify as a Semifinalist. Only 737,000 juniors were able to take the October 2020 PSAT/NMSQT, which is just 44% of the October 2019 level of 1.7 million. As outlined at the top of this article, SAT scores from alternate entrants are not used in calculating cutoffs.
